The title "Audemars Piguet Nautilus Preis" is slightly misleading. The Nautilus is not an Audemars Piguet collection; it is a highly coveted and iconic collection from Patek Philippe. Audemars Piguet, while a prestigious watchmaker in its own right, boasts its own renowned collection, the Royal Oak, which shares a similar design philosophy and historical significance with the Patek Philippe Nautilus. Patek Philippe Nautilus Retail Price: A World of Variation

Determining a precise "Patek Philippe Nautilus preis" is impossible without specifying the exact model. The range is astonishingly wide, spanning from approximately $28,000 to an eye-watering $551,000. This vast price spectrum reflects the diverse range of materials, complications, and limited editions within the Nautilus collection. The average price hovers around $101,000, but this figure is heavily skewed by the inclusion of highly sought-after and rare pieces. For potential buyers, understanding the factors contributing to this price variability is crucial.

Patek Philippe Nautilus Models: A Diverse Landscape

The Nautilus collection boasts a diverse array of models, each contributing to the price spectrum. Understanding these variations is key to comprehending the pricing structure. Some key factors influencing price include:

* Material: The most significant factor is the case material. Steel models, while still highly desirable, represent the more accessible end of the spectrum. However, even within steel models, variations in dial color or specific limited editions can significantly increase price. Gold models, particularly those in yellow, rose, or white gold, command substantially higher prices due to the inherent value of the precious metal and increased manufacturing complexity.

* Complications: The inclusion of complications – added functions beyond simple timekeeping – drastically increases the price. A simple three-hand Nautilus will be significantly cheaper than a model featuring a chronograph, perpetual calendar, or moon phase. These complications require more intricate movements, demanding greater craftsmanship and expertise.

* Dial variations: Even within a specific material and complication set, variations in dial color, texture, and embellishments can dramatically affect price. Rare dial colors or unique patterns can command substantial premiums from collectors.

* Limited Editions: Patek Philippe frequently releases limited-edition Nautilus models, often commemorating anniversaries or collaborations. These limited-run pieces are highly sought after by collectors, driving prices far beyond the standard models. The rarity and exclusivity significantly enhance their value.

* Condition and Authenticity: The condition of the watch is paramount. A pristine, unpolished watch in its original box and papers will command a significantly higher price than a worn or damaged piece. Authenticity is also critical; purchasing from reputable dealers is essential to avoid counterfeits.

Patek Philippe Nautilus 5711 Price: A Case Study in Desirability

The Patek Philippe Nautilus 5711 is arguably the most iconic and widely recognized model within the collection. Its clean lines, elegant proportions, and sporty aesthetic have made it a perennial favorite. The price for a pre-owned 5711 in steel can easily exceed its original retail price, often commanding hundreds of thousands of dollars in the secondary market, particularly since its discontinuation. This surge in price highlights the intense demand and collectibility of this particular model.
